The Interactive Context allows you to manage //! graphic behavior and selection of Interactive Objects //! in one or more viewers. Class methods make this //! highly transparent. //! It is essential to remember that an Interactive Object //! which is already known by the Interactive Context //! must be modified using Context methods. You can //! only directly call the methods available for an //! Interactive Object if it has not been loaded into an //! Interactive Context. //! You must distinguish two states in the Interactive Context: //! - No Open Local Context, also known as the Neutral Point. //! - One or several open local contexts, each //! representing a temporary state of selection and presentation. //! Some methods can only be used in open Local //! Context; others in closed Local Context; others do //! not have the same behavior in one state as in the other. //! The possiblities of use for local contexts are //! numerous depending on the type of operation that //! you want to perform, for example: //! - working on all visualized interactive objects, //! - working on only a few objects, //! - working on a single object. //! 1. When you want ot work on one type of entity, you //! may open a local context with the option //! UseDisplayedObjects set to false. DisplayedObjects //! allows you to recover the visualized Interactive //! Objects which have a given Type and //! Signature from Neutral Point. //! 2. You must keep in mind the fact that when you open //! a Local Context with default options: //! - The Interactive Objects visualized at Neutral Point //! are activated with their default selection mode. You //! must deactivate those which you do not want ot use. //! - The Shape type Interactive Objects are //! automatically decomposed into sub-shapes when //! standard activation modes are launched. //! - The "temporary" Interactive Objects present in the //! Local Contexts are not automatically taken into //! account. You have to load them manually if you //! want to use them. //! - The stages could be the following: //! - Open a Local Context with the right options; //! - Load/Visualize the required complementary //! objects with the desired activation modes. //! - Activate Standard modes if necessary //! - Create its filters and add them to the Local Context //! - Detect/Select/recover the desired entities //! - Close the Local Context with the adequate index. //! - It is useful to create an interactive editor, to which //! you pass the Interactive Context. This will take care //! of setting up the different contexts of //! selection/presentation according to the operation //! which you want to perform. //! Selection of parts of the objects can also be done without opening a local context. //! Interactive context itself supports decomposed object selection with selection filters //! support. Note that each selectable object must specify the selection mode that is //! responsible for selection of object as a whole (global selection mode). By default, global //! selection mode is equal to 0, but it might be redefined if needed. Sub-part selection //! of the objects without using local context provides a possibility to activate part //! selection modes along with global selection mode. class AIS_InteractiveContext : public MMgt_TShared { public: //! Drawings of curves or patches are made with respect //! to a maximal chordal deviation. A Deviation coefficient //! is used in the shading display mode. The shape is //! seen decomposed into triangles. These are used to //! calculate reflection of light from the surface of the //! object. The triangles are formed from chords of the //! curves in the shape. The deviation coefficient //! aCoefficient gives the highest value of the angle with //! which a chord can deviate from a tangent to a curve. //! If this limit is reached, a new triangle is begun. //! This deviation is absolute and is set through the //! method: SetMaximalChordialDeviation. The default //! value is 0.001. //! In drawing shapes, however, you are allowed to ask //! for a relative deviation. This deviation will be: //! Opens local contexts and specifies how this is to be //! done. The options listed above function in the following manner: //! - UseDisplayedObjects -allows you to load or not //! load the interactive objects visualized at Neutral //! Point in the local context which you open. If false, //! the local context is empty after being opened. If //! true, the objects at Neutral Point are loaded by their //! default selection mode. //! - AllowShapeDecomposition -AIS_Shape allows or //! prevents decomposition in standard shape location //! mode of objects at Neutral Point which are //! type-"privileged". This Flag is only taken into //! account when UseDisplayedObjects is true. //! - AcceptEraseOfObjects -authorises other local //! contexts to erase the interactive objects present in //! this context. This option is rarely used. //! - BothViewers - Has no use currently defined. //! This method returns the index of the created local //! context. It should be kept and used to close the context. //! Opening a local context allows you to prepare an //! environment for temporary presentations and //! selections which will disappear once the local context is closed. //! You can open several local contexts, but only the last //! one will be active.
